Tata Technology reported a 15% decline in its consolidated net profit for the first quarter ended June 2024. Income from operations increased marginally during the reporting period to Rs. 1,269 crores. A year ago it was Rs. 1,257 crores.
Operating EBITDA for the June quarter was Rs. 231 crore, while the margin was 18.2% in the period. Segment-wise, services revenue declined 1% quarter-on-quarter in the April-June 2024 period to Rs. 985 crore has been done.
The company said overall market conditions remain favorable as the manufacturing sector continues to future-proof itself through ongoing investments in alternative propulsion systems, software-defined products and services, and smart manufacturing.
“Confidence in our full-year prospects is bolstered by continued positive momentum in our order book, our anchor accounts and tailwinds that we expect to continue to intersect with automotive, aerospace and industrial heavy machinery,” said Warren Harris, CEO and CEO. MD, Tata Tech.
Tata Tech won five strategic deals in automotive and aerospace during the reporting quarter.
The company said its strong cash flow management and efficient collection process are priorities going forward.
